God the Father
By: Adam M. Snow
To be at the sight of all beauty and grace,
and seek guidance in your glorious place.
To be still and in awe of you,
and to know you made me new.
To be welcome in your open arms,
and see all around the Heavenly charms.
To you God the Father, who art in Heaven,
let your will be done, let this place be haven.
To you my Father, the one who's beguiled,
who wants me to run to him, your once lost child.
To you my Redeemer and Strong Tower,
whose with me each beloved hour.
May I say unto you,
for I know it's true,
for all the love you've poured,
thank you O Lord.
You forgave my each and every sin,
and I end this prayer O Lord Amen.
